Ceiling Demons, hailing from Richmond, North Yorkshire, UK, are redefining the art rap genre. This alternative music outfit emerged from personal loss, channeling their experiences into a compelling sound influenced by legends like Nick Cave & The Bad Seeds, Ceschi, and Tricky. With twin brothers Psy Ceiling and Dan Demon at the helm, their poetic lyricism is set against vibrant, cinematic instrumentals.
Their performances are known for being intense and chaotic, striking deep emotional chords as they tackle themes of love, loss, and mental health. Advocating for mental well-being, Ceiling Demons actively support charities like CALM, using their platform to raise awareness and funds. With a punk ethos, they emphasize art over mere entertainment, inviting listeners to connect with their message.
Fans of live performances by alternative bands will appreciate their dynamic shows, where they’ve shared the stage with top independent artists such as Young Fathers and Sleaford Mods. Praised by outlets like Louder Than War and NARC Magazine, Ceiling Demons are not just a band; they’re a movement.
